CPU Tech produces the Acalis® family of secure processors that protect software and systems from reverse engineering. Acalis enables the development of secure and compatible electronics modernization technology solving obsolescence problems while reducing size, weight and power (SWAP).
The Acalis secure processors directly address the need for anti-tamper (AT) technology in todays critical computing and communications systems while providing a trusted, long-term supply. As the strongest protection available for software and systems, Acalis protects algorithms, rules and data from cloning, malicious insertion and countermeasures.
CPU Techs 100% software compatible electronics modernization extends the life of platforms, vehicles and systems while improving performance and capacity for new capabilities and avoiding the cost and delay of software modifications. Our proven technology reduces obsolescence and SWAP while addressing anti-tamper security needs with Acalis. CPU Techs advanced verification and integration capabilities are achieved through the SystemLab PS® platform simulator, which reduces lifecycle management costs for the duration of the system.
CPU Tech is a privately held company founded in 1989 and headquartered in Pleasanton, California.
